Most households in Swobodaville have increasing expenditures each subsequent year. This can be attributed to changes in consumption levels of the population which is influenced by reduction in product prices. The reduction in prices directly increases households' consumption since their wealth's real value increases. This effect on consumption will finally transmit to the aggregate expenditure, therefore, affecting it positively as witnessed in the past five years. The other cause of the higher expenditure is low interest rates. The lower the interest rates, the higher bank borrowings; thus increase investments and consumption expenditures. This will increase the aggregate expenditure. The level of wealth for households, and in the economy as well, affects the consumption and investment components of aggregate expenditure. Increase in financial wealth increases the consumption and investment expenditure power of households.
